Peel Away 7

Peel Away 7 uses a unique paste-and-paper method to strip paint from wood. It is widely regarded as one of the best paint stripper for wood UK products due to its efficiency and ease of use. Simply apply the paste, cover it with the special paper, and let it do its magic. This method contains the mess and ensures thorough paint removal without damaging the wood surface.

FAQs

Q1. What should I consider when choosing a paint stripper for wood?

When selecting a paint stripper for wood, consider factors such as the type of paint you need to remove, the number of layers, and the size of your project. Additionally, think about whether you prefer eco-friendly or chemical-based solutions, and whether you’ll be working indoors or outdoors.

Q2. How can I ensure a paint stripper won’t damage the wood surface?

To prevent damage, always test the stripper on a small, inconspicuous area first. Follow the manufacturer’s instructions carefully, and avoid leaving the stripper on for longer than recommended. Use appropriate tools to scrape the paint, and avoid excessive force to prevent scratches or gouges.

Q3. Are there eco-friendly paint strippers available?

Yes, there are eco-friendly options that use biodegradable and non-toxic formulas. These strippers are generally safer for indoor use and pose less risk to the environment. Products with water-based formulations are typically more environmentally friendly.

Q4. What safety precautions should I take when using a paint stripper?

Always wear protective gear, including gloves and safety goggles, when working with paint strippers. Ensure the area is well-ventilated to avoid inhaling fumes. Keep children and pets away from the work area, and follow all safety instructions provided by the manufacturer.

Q5. How do I clean up after using a paint stripper?

After removing paint, use a damp cloth or sponge to wipe away any residue. Some strippers might require additional cleaning with soapy water or a neutralizing solution. Dispose of paint waste according to local regulations, and ensure the work area is clean and free from hazardous materials.
